Step 2: Water Extraction

Next, we’ll use state-of-the-art equipment to extract as much water as possible from your property. This includes wet vacuums, pumps, and other specialized tools designed to get the job done quickly and efficiently. We’ll remove every last drop. No exceptions. No mess left behind.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your property. This includes air movers, dehumidifiers, and other tools designed to remove moisture and prevent further damage. We’ll get your property dry. And we’ll keep it that way. No lingering moisture.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ning

Finally, we’ll sanitize and clean your property to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This includes using spec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ove any remaining moisture and debris. We’ll leave your property clean. And safe. No lingering issues.

How do I prevent sewer backups?

To prevent sewer backups, be sure to keep grease and debris out of your drains, avoid flushing items that can clog your pipes, and have your drains regularly inspected and cleaned. Don’t wait to get help. Call a pro. Get the job done right.
